Originally Posted by xXHotelCrazyXx
How do you remove the air bag cover? Is it simple?
its simple, just take it one step at a time, and take your time.
you need to disconnect your battery and make sure all the power is gone (i pressed my brakes to use any left over power). 2 security torx bolts, one each side of the steering wheel. 2 more bolts to remove the airbag unit. and then unplug the wires. then slip the cover off and swap with the new one. and then reassemble. when slipping the new cover on make sure it Does Not pinch the airbag. there is also a diy with pixs here someplace. good luck.
